Core Skills Analysis
Creative Arts
- The student engaged in imaginative play by creating a game inspired by Bluey, which fosters creativity and original thought.
- Role-playing scenarios from the show enabled the child to experiment with different characters and situations, helping them explore narrative structure.
- The game involves physical actions and movements, which promotes gross motor development and spatial awareness.
- Collaborating with peers or family members during the game enhances social skills, including sharing and turn-taking.
Literacy
- The child demonstrates emergent literacy skills by using vocabulary and dialogues inspired by Bluey, enriching their language development.
- Creating a game based on a television show connects spoken language with visual storytelling, reinforcing comprehension.
- The child learns to follow simple rules and instructions, which aids in literacy through understanding sequence and structure.
- Discussing the game with others helps the student articulate thoughts and enhances their verbal expression.
Social Skills
- Playing a game with others fosters cooperation, teaching the importance of working together and understanding different perspectives.
- Role-playing different characters allows the child to exhibit empathy by considering how others might feel in various situations.
- The activity encourages conflict resolution skills, as the child might need to negotiate rules or resolve disagreements during play.
- The child's ability to express emotions and reactions while playing reflects their emotional intelligence development.
Tips
To further enhance your child's learning experience related to the activity, consider incorporating storytelling elements into their playtime. Ask open-ended questions to encourage critical thinking, such as 'What would happen if Bluey encountered a new friend?' or 'How would the characters solve a problem together?' Additionally, introducing themed activities that relate to the game can strengthen their comprehension and apply new vocabulary. Finally, create opportunities for the child to share their experiences and thoughts with others, further developing their communication skills.
